Check Cooler’s Fan Noise
Even when there isn’t much load, the cooling system’s fan can make more noise and run at its highest RPM. This can be a sign that the cooler is broken.
You can hear the noise, but a number you can see can prove that it is real. You can use BIOS, SpeedFan, HWiNFO, etc. to check the speed of the fan on the cooler.

For BIOS, you can get there by pressing the key that your motherboard maker gives you, such as the Delete key or F2. During boot, press the Del key on the X570 Aorus Master motherboard to get into BIOS. In EASY MODE, the CPU fan speed is in the Smart Fan section, which is in the middle of the bottom.

You can keep an eye on different hardware sensors with HWiNFO:
- Get the version of the software that you can take with you.
- Sensors-only will let you open it.
- Scroll down and find the section for the model of your motherboard.

There, you can find the RPM speed of the CPU fan and the speeds of other system fans.
If the fan is running at full speed, it could mean that it can’t get rid of the heat from the dust or that the bearings are getting loose.
Look for Physical Damage to the Cooler Fan’s Blade
The fan blade can get damaged or broken. If that’s true, it won’t work right and won’t be able to spread the heat from the heat sink. This will cause the temperature of the chip to rise, which will eventually make the fan spin faster. If you don’t take the right steps quickly, you will fail.

You can open the side panel of the case and look at the cooling fan to see if there is a physical problem. If it breaks, you should get a new one right away.
Track Down Processor Temperature
It’s not necessary to check the temperature of hardware on a regular basis, but it’s important to keep an eye on it. Because high temperatures can even burn things.
HWiNFO can be used to check the temperature. A lot of people use this free software to keep an eye on different sensors.
Here’s how to use the app to check the CPU temperature:
- Sensors-only is used to open HWiNFO.
- Go to the section for your CPU’s model name.

There you’ll see the temperature of your CPU. If it’s too hot and the CPU slows down because of it, the software will show the temperature in red. This high temperature shows that the CPU cooler isn’t doing its job and isn’t enough for the chip.
Stress Test the Chip
You can also test how well the CPU cooler works by putting the processor under stress. During intense gaming or stress testing, it puts a lot of stress on the chip, which makes it get used a lot. This causes a lot of power to be used, which makes the temperature rise.

If the cooling system is strong enough to deal with the heat, it will work fine. But if the cooler is broken, it won’t be able to keep the chip’s temperature in a safe range, which can cause a lot of damage.
Inspect the CPU Cooler’s Position
To get a good look at how the cooler is put in, you should take the motherboard out of the case. So that you can check the position of the cooler and make sure the CPU cooler is in the right place.
Here are the steps to verify a cooler’s placement:
- Open casing’s side panel.
- Carefully unscrew the screw on the motherboard from the case.

- Be careful when you take the motherboard out of the case.
- Check to see if all the cooler’s clips or screws are tight enough.
- Check to see if the heat sink is attached to the CPU evenly and correctly.

How to Maintain the CPU Cooler
For the cooler to work well, it’s important to keep the cooling system in good shape. You need to know the differences between air CPU coolers, all-in-one (AIO) coolers, and custom water loop coolers.
CPU coolers that use air are easy to install and keep up. Most of the time, this kind of cooler has a heat sink and one or two fans. To keep this kind of cooler in good shape, you only need to clean the fan and take the dust off the heat sink. If the fan breaks, you just need to switch it out for a new one.
AIO coolers work better than air coolers to cool down the chip. There are two or three fans, a radiator, and a heat sink in these coolers. To make sure air flows well, you need to clean the fan and radiator.
The expensive one is the one with the custom water loop, but it also cools the parts down a lot. This needs to be taken care of by a professional, since a leak of liquid can damage all of the computer parts inside the case.
For this kind of cooler, the most important thing is to make sure the pump works well and that the pipe doesn’t leak.
How Long Does a Cooler Fan Last? What Happens to Your PC Then?
If you don’t take care of your cooler properly, like we talked about above, it won’t work as well as it could. If you use an old cooler, the fan will also stop working after a while.
So, if a CPU cooler fan stops working, your computer will overheat right away. If you notice that the CPU fan has died, you should turn off your PC right away.
Even though Intel and AMD CPUs have safety features that will start to slow down the clock speed to lower the temperature, if that doesn’t work, the system will shut down. It will also show CPU Overheat Temperature Error the next time it starts up.
So, in general, how long does a cooler fan last?
Well, it depends on how good the fan is, but if you take care of it, it should last between 4 and 5 years. The heat sink can last for a long time if it doesn’t get dusty or rusty.
How to Pick a CPU Cooler
If you’re reading this, it’s likely that your cooler is broken or not working as well as it should. So, if you want to buy a new CPU cooler, you need to keep a few things in mind.
Before you buy a new CPU cooler, you need to pay attention to the following things:
- TDP of CPU: A Thermal Design Power, or TDP, value is assigned to every processor by the manufacturer. This displays how much heat the chip spreads. Checking a cooler’s ability to determine whether it is capable of working with the exact CPU you already own is an absolute necessity before purchasing a new CPU cooler.

- Casing Clearance: For each case specification, they say how far away the CPU cooler can be. Most of the time, a cooler with a 120 mm fan needs 160 mm of space around it. So make sure there is enough room on the sides of the casing. If not, you have to choose a 90 mm fan, which might not be enough for your CPU, or you might have to choose an AIO cooler or something else.
- RAM Clearance: Before you buy a new air cooler, you should also check the RAM clearance. Some air coolers have 3 fans with heat sinks on both sides. This takes up a lot of room and may cause problems with your RAM.

- Size of the Cooler: The size of the cooler also affects how well it works. A mid-tower air cooler can’t cool as well as a tower air cooler. So you need to choose the right size for your needs.
- Motherboard Sockets Compatible: Since newer chips have different sockets, mainboards sometimes change how the cooler’s bracket works. So, it’s very important to make sure that a cooler works well with the motherboard.

How hot is too hot for CPU?
At full load, the average temperature of your CPU can reach 80–85°C, but this is the absolute max. If the CPU temperature stays above 80°C for a long time, it can damage the silicon inside the CPU. If your CPU’s temperature stays above 90°C for a long time, it may shorten the life of your processor.
